At the end of the year, the Luna browser will be released in Russia. The application is currently in open testing on the App Store with limited functionality.
Luna will allow you to not only work with popular services, but also use financial services. As development progresses, services will be built into the browser to allow online purchases. In the future, project partners will be able to take advantage of extensions that improve the user experience, such as the address book and push notifications.
Domestic certificates of the Ministry of Digital Development are embedded in the new browser. “Luna” only opens verified sites that are visually highlighted in green for the user. “Adult” and shocking content is not bypassed by the app.
The browser blocks ads and trackers that collect and monitor information about pages viewed by users. The developers emphasize that as a result, sites load faster and mobile traffic consumption is reduced.
The company Innovative Development, which created the scanner, plans to fully launch the product by the end of the year. Currently having limited functionality, the app can be installed on iOS devices and will be available for Android devices in the future.
